Kerberos에서 krb5libs를 어떻게 제거해야 합니까?

Kerberos에서 krb5libs를 어떻게 제거해야 합니까?

krb5libs를 제거할 수 없습니다.

krb5lib를 제거하는 동안 다음 오류가 발생했습니다.

yum remove krb5-libs

Error: Trying to remove "systemd", which is protected
Error: Trying to remove "yum", which is protected

답변1

일부 패키지는 불완전한 상태이므로 정리가 필요할 수 있습니다.

기사 yum 불완전한 거래 수정 다음 스크립트를 제공합니다.

package-cleanup --dupes | grep -v Loaded | awk 'NR % 2 == 0' | xargs -n1 rpm -e --nodeps --justdb --noscripts
yum update
yum-complete-transaction
yum -y reinstall kernel

설명은 첫 번째 명령이 중복 RPM 목록을 가져오고 명령을 사용하여 awk각 두 줄 중 하나를 가져오는 것입니다. 이는 제거 스크립트를 실행하거나 실제로 디스크에서 파일을 제거하지 않고 각 RPM을 제거된 것으로 표시하기 위해 rpm으로 파이프됩니다.

관련 정보